The LTM8047IY is a versatile and robust micro-module converter manufactured by Analog Devices Inc., designed to meet the needs of a wide range of applications requiring efficient power conversion. This high-performance component is part of the µModule (micro-module) family, which integrates the inductor, power switches, and all supporting components into a compact, surface-mount package. This integration simplifies design and enhances reliability, making it an ideal solution for designers looking to reduce development time and improve system performance.
Featuring an input voltage range of 3.1V to 32V and an adjustable output voltage range from 2.5V to 12.5V, the LTM8047IY is capable of delivering up to 2.5W of output power. This wide input range allows for flexibility in various applications, including industrial, automotive, and telecommunications systems. The device also supports a high-efficiency synchronous switching architecture, which contributes to reduced power losses and improved thermal performance.
The LTM8047IY boasts an impressive array of protective features to ensure stability and longevity. These include over-temperature protection, over-current protection, and input under-voltage lockout, safeguarding the device and the system it powers from a range of potential issues. Additionally, the micro-module's encapsulated design provides enhanced resistance to environmental factors such as dust, moisture, and shock, making it suitable for harsh environments.
For engineers looking to streamline their power supply designs, the LTM8047IY's compact LGA (Land Grid Array) package measures just 9mm x 11.25mm x 4.92mm, saving valuable board space while still delivering powerful performance. Furthermore, the LTM8047IY is RoHS compliant, adhering to current environmental standards and regulations.
